Where to Start: Highest Impact Areas

Focus first on customer support (chatbots), marketing content (AI writing and images), sales follow-ups (automated emails), and operations (inventory or scheduling). These areas deliver fast, measurable results with minimal disruption.

  • Customer service – instant answers 24/7
  • Marketing – faster content creation
  • Sales – lead qualification and follow-up
  • Operations – forecasting and automation

Step-by-Step Guide to Integrating AI

1. Identify one painful or time-consuming process. 2. Research free or low-cost AI tools that solve it. 3. Test the tool on a small scale. 4. Train your team (or yourself) with simple prompts and workflows. 5. Integrate with existing tools using Zapier if needed. 6. Measure results and expand to the next area.

Best AI Tools for Small Businesses in 2026

Start with ChatGPT or Grok for writing and ideas, ManyChat or similar for chatbots, Canva Magic Studio or Midjourney for visuals, and Zapier to connect everything without coding. These tools are user-friendly and have generous free tiers.

Real Examples and Expected ROI

A small retail shop used AI chatbots to handle 75% of customer inquiries, saving 15 hours per week. A service business automated proposal writing and increased output by 40%. Many businesses report payback periods of 2-6 months when starting small.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

Fear of technology, data privacy concerns, and staff resistance are common. Start small, involve your team early, choose reputable tools with good privacy policies, and provide simple training. Always keep human oversight for important decisions.

FAQs – Integrating AI into Small Business

How long does it take to see results?
Simple automations can show benefits within 1-4 weeks. More complex integrations usually take 1-3 months.

Is AI safe for customer data?
Use tools with strong privacy policies and avoid sharing sensitive information. Many platforms offer enterprise-grade security even on affordable plans.

Do I need to hire an expert?
Not necessarily. Many small business owners successfully implement AI themselves using no-code tools and online tutorials.
